Rancho San Bernardo is nestled in the heart of San Diego's North County, approximately 30 miles north of downtown San Diego. The community is situated near the intersection of Interstate 15 and Highway 56, making it easily accessible to major employment centers, shopping districts, and entertainment venues. The community of Rancho San Bernardo is known for its excellent schools, beautiful parks, and abundant recreational opportunities. The area is served by the Poway Unified School District, which is highly regarded for its academic excellence and innovative programs. Residents of Rancho San Bernardo also enjoy access to numerous parks, trails, and open spaces, including the beautiful Lake Hodges and the surrounding hills and canyons.
